Current ways of organizing work seem unfit for the future and we are exploring new ways: flat (as in distributed), transparent and agile! HR has an important role in guiding the organization in this transition. Moreover, current HR themes & tools need a drastic revision to support the agile organization and it is about time to reflect on the impact this transition has on the role of HR. 

How will the organization of the future look like? How can HR support the organization in the transition from a traditional to an agile organization? What impact does ‘becoming more agile’ have on current HR-themes & tooling, for example on recruitment, learning & development, performance management and reorganizations? Which HR-roles are needed during the phase of transition and which roles are needed in the organization of the future? And: how can HR embrace agile ways of working and apply the basics in its own practices?

In this online training program we will dive deeper into these questions, each module divided in an inspirational part, an active work session (using agile and design thinking methodologies such as sprints, user stories, retrospectives etc. to improve the real life experience) and moments of reflection.

Get inspired by new perspectives & frameworks, experiences and insights from other organizations and discover how and where you can start to get the organization, HR and yourself moving!

For who is this training?
This training is designed for HR Directors, HR Managers and HR & Organizational Advisors who are involved with the transition from old to new ways of working, autonomous teams & ownership, redesigning the organization into a more agile ‘shape’ and growing & scaling up without the introduction of unnecessary management layers and bureaucracy.

CERTIFICATION-ASSIGNMENT

In this assignment you will demonstrate that the inspiration (content offered) and the interaction (exercises and discussions) during the training resulted in a thorough understanding of the four agile themes (agile ways of working, flexible organizing, people- and value driven leadership and shared purpose & relevance) and the ability to put this theory into practice and add value to the  business.

> Assignment:  Choose an existing HR challenge or project* within your organization and show how you approached this with the framework of The 12 Ingredients.

> Form: Hand in your work by using the ‘12 Ingredients Canvas’ and a brief explanatory video or voice recording of 5 to 10 minutes within the agreed deadline (approx. 4-6 weeks after finalizing the online program).

> Evaluation: You will receive reflections and feedback from the trainer based on the before discussed criteria. The assignment will be evaluated with ‘passed’ or ‘almost passed’ (in which case you can adjust and hand in again). Once passed you will receive the much sought after Pizza-certificate: Agile HR & Transition Leader!
